This appeal has been filed against the order of the District Consumer Disputes Redressal Commission, Puducherry (District Commission in short hereafter) in CC No.18 of 2016 wherein the District Commission found the services of the appellant herein (Electricity Department, Puducherry) to be deficient and awarded compensation. The complaint was filed by V.A. Vasudevaraju, a consumer of the Electricity Department in Puducherry, following a series of billing disputes and service failures that began in 2011.
The narrative of his complaint is as follows:
2. The issue originated when the complainant received abnormally high monthly energy bills for April 2011, July 2012, and August 2012, which amounted to Rs.
3,583, Rs. 33,547, and Rs. 87,724, respectively. Despite sending multiple written representations via speed post to various officials in the Electricity Department requesting bill revisions, he received no corrective action or formal reply. Instead, in October 2012, the department sent him a brief letter demanding a payment of Rs.85,002/- without providing any itemized details.
3. The complainant contended that the department failed in its duty to maintain and replace defective electricity meters promptly. He further alleged that while the department refused to correct the disputed bills, they also followed a practice of refusing to accept payments for subsequent normal monthly bills until the disputed arrears were cleared. This cycle led the department to resort to removing his fuse and disconnecting his power three times without notice, which the complainant viewed as an attempt to force payment while the dispute was still pending.
4. Before approaching the Consumer Commission, the complainant had filed a case with the Consumer Grievances Redressal Forum (CGRF) in 2013. The Forum ruled in his favor, directing the department to drop a claim for Rs. 49,900 and issue corrected bills.
